|
@@ -54,8 +54,8 @@
|
|
</div>
|
|
</div>
|
|
</div>
|
|
</div>
|
|
<div class="query-actions">
|
|
<div class="query-actions">
|
|
- <button class="btn" @click="mxClick()">搜索</button>
|
|
|
|
- <button class="btn green">明细信息</button>
|
|
|
|
|
|
+ <button class="btn">搜索</button>
|
|
|
|
+ <button class="btn green" @click="mxClick()">明细信息</button>
|
|
<button class="btn">导出</button>
|
|
<button class="btn">导出</button>
|
|
</div>
|
|
</div>
|
|
</div>
|
|
</div>
|
|
@@ -68,22 +68,14 @@
|
|
<div class="activeMx">
|
|
<div class="activeMx">
|
|
<el-row :type="'flex'" class="content">
|
|
<el-row :type="'flex'" class="content">
|
|
<el-col :span="12" class="pd-r-8">
|
|
<el-col :span="12" class="pd-r-8">
|
|
- <toolbar-panel :title="toolTitle" :showLine="false">
|
|
|
|
- <template v-slot:tools>
|
|
|
|
- <div class="tools">
|
|
|
|
- <div class="tool-block" v-for="item in tool">
|
|
|
|
- <div class="legend" :class="item.color"></div>
|
|
|
|
- <div class="legend-text">{{item.name}}</div>
|
|
|
|
- </div>
|
|
|
|
- </div>
|
|
|
|
- </template>
|
|
|
|
- <bar-line-chart :height="'calc(100vh - 200px)'" :bardata="bardata" :lineData="lineData" />
|
|
|
|
|
|
+ <toolbar-panel title="风机绩效榜明细" :showLine="false">
|
|
|
|
+ <bar-line-chart :height="'calc(100vh - 200px)'" :bardata="bardata" :lineData="lineData" :color="barColor" lineName="理论发电量"/>
|
|
</toolbar-panel>
|
|
</toolbar-panel>
|
|
</el-col>
|
|
</el-col>
|
|
<el-col :span="12" class="pd-l-8">
|
|
<el-col :span="12" class="pd-l-8">
|
|
<panel :title="'项目列表'" :showLine="false">
|
|
<panel :title="'项目列表'" :showLine="false">
|
|
<div class="project-table">
|
|
<div class="project-table">
|
|
- <Table :data="tableData" @toClick="(res) => { this.thClick(res); }"></Table>
|
|
|
|
|
|
+ <Table :data="tableData"></Table>
|
|
</div>
|
|
</div>
|
|
</panel>
|
|
</panel>
|
|
</el-col>
|
|
</el-col>
|
|
@@ -127,96 +119,112 @@
|
|
field: "llfdl",
|
|
field: "llfdl",
|
|
is_num: false,
|
|
is_num: false,
|
|
is_light: false,
|
|
is_light: false,
|
|
|
|
+ sortable:true
|
|
},
|
|
},
|
|
{
|
|
{
|
|
name: "SCADA发电量",
|
|
name: "SCADA发电量",
|
|
field: "sjfdl",
|
|
field: "sjfdl",
|
|
is_num: false,
|
|
is_num: false,
|
|
is_light: false,
|
|
is_light: false,
|
|
|
|
+ sortable:true
|
|
},
|
|
},
|
|
{
|
|
{
|
|
name: "风速",
|
|
name: "风速",
|
|
field: "speed",
|
|
field: "speed",
|
|
is_num: false,
|
|
is_num: false,
|
|
is_light: false,
|
|
is_light: false,
|
|
|
|
+ sortable:true
|
|
},
|
|
},
|
|
{
|
|
{
|
|
name: "故障损失",
|
|
name: "故障损失",
|
|
field: "fjhjx1",
|
|
field: "fjhjx1",
|
|
is_num: false,
|
|
is_num: false,
|
|
is_light: false,
|
|
is_light: false,
|
|
|
|
+ sortable:true
|
|
},
|
|
},
|
|
{
|
|
{
|
|
name: "故障受累",
|
|
name: "故障受累",
|
|
field: "fjhjx2",
|
|
field: "fjhjx2",
|
|
is_num: false,
|
|
is_num: false,
|
|
is_light: false,
|
|
is_light: false,
|
|
|
|
+ sortable:true
|
|
},
|
|
},
|
|
{
|
|
{
|
|
name: "检修损失",
|
|
name: "检修损失",
|
|
field: "jhjx1",
|
|
field: "jhjx1",
|
|
is_num: false,
|
|
is_num: false,
|
|
is_light: false,
|
|
is_light: false,
|
|
|
|
+ sortable:true
|
|
},
|
|
},
|
|
{
|
|
{
|
|
name: "检修受累",
|
|
name: "检修受累",
|
|
field: "jhjx2",
|
|
field: "jhjx2",
|
|
is_num: false,
|
|
is_num: false,
|
|
is_light: false,
|
|
is_light: false,
|
|
|
|
+ sortable:true
|
|
},
|
|
},
|
|
{
|
|
{
|
|
name: "电网受累",
|
|
name: "电网受累",
|
|
field: "sl1",
|
|
field: "sl1",
|
|
is_num: false,
|
|
is_num: false,
|
|
is_light: false,
|
|
is_light: false,
|
|
|
|
+ sortable:true
|
|
},
|
|
},
|
|
{
|
|
{
|
|
name: "天气受累",
|
|
name: "天气受累",
|
|
field: "sl2",
|
|
field: "sl2",
|
|
is_num: false,
|
|
is_num: false,
|
|
is_light: false,
|
|
is_light: false,
|
|
|
|
+ sortable:true
|
|
},
|
|
},
|
|
{
|
|
{
|
|
name: "限电降出",
|
|
name: "限电降出",
|
|
field: "xd1",
|
|
field: "xd1",
|
|
is_num: false,
|
|
is_num: false,
|
|
is_light: false,
|
|
is_light: false,
|
|
|
|
+ sortable:true
|
|
},
|
|
},
|
|
{
|
|
{
|
|
name: "限电停机",
|
|
name: "限电停机",
|
|
field: "xd2",
|
|
field: "xd2",
|
|
is_num: false,
|
|
is_num: false,
|
|
is_light: false,
|
|
is_light: false,
|
|
|
|
+ sortable:true
|
|
},
|
|
},
|
|
{
|
|
{
|
|
name: "待风损失",
|
|
name: "待风损失",
|
|
field: "xn1",
|
|
field: "xn1",
|
|
is_num: false,
|
|
is_num: false,
|
|
is_light: false,
|
|
is_light: false,
|
|
|
|
+ sortable:true
|
|
},
|
|
},
|
|
{
|
|
{
|
|
name: "手动停机",
|
|
name: "手动停机",
|
|
field: "xn2",
|
|
field: "xn2",
|
|
is_num: false,
|
|
is_num: false,
|
|
is_light: false,
|
|
is_light: false,
|
|
|
|
+ sortable:true
|
|
},
|
|
},
|
|
{
|
|
{
|
|
name: "正常发电",
|
|
name: "正常发电",
|
|
field: "xn3",
|
|
field: "xn3",
|
|
is_num: false,
|
|
is_num: false,
|
|
is_light: false,
|
|
is_light: false,
|
|
|
|
+ sortable:true
|
|
},
|
|
},
|
|
{
|
|
{
|
|
name: "缺陷降出",
|
|
name: "缺陷降出",
|
|
field: "xn4",
|
|
field: "xn4",
|
|
is_num: false,
|
|
is_num: false,
|
|
is_light: false,
|
|
is_light: false,
|
|
|
|
+ sortable:true
|
|
},
|
|
},
|
|
{
|
|
{
|
|
name: "风能利用率%",
|
|
name: "风能利用率%",
|
|
field: "fnlly",
|
|
field: "fnlly",
|
|
is_num: false,
|
|
is_num: false,
|
|
is_light: false,
|
|
is_light: false,
|
|
|
|
+ sortable:true
|
|
}
|
|
}
|
|
],
|
|
],
|
|
data: [],
|
|
data: [],
|
|
@@ -232,45 +240,6 @@
|
|
TypeClass: 1, //风场,项目,集电线路 的按钮颜色,默认第一个
|
|
TypeClass: 1, //风场,项目,集电线路 的按钮颜色,默认第一个
|
|
bardata: [],
|
|
bardata: [],
|
|
lineData: [],
|
|
lineData: [],
|
|
- toolTitle: '风机绩效榜明细',
|
|
|
|
- tool: [{
|
|
|
|
- color: 'bg-purple',
|
|
|
|
- name: '实际电量'
|
|
|
|
- }, {
|
|
|
|
- color: 'bg-blue',
|
|
|
|
- name: '故障损失'
|
|
|
|
- }, {
|
|
|
|
- color: 'bg-green',
|
|
|
|
- name: '故障受累'
|
|
|
|
- }, {
|
|
|
|
- color: 'bg-red',
|
|
|
|
- name: '检修受累'
|
|
|
|
- }, {
|
|
|
|
- color: 'bg-orange',
|
|
|
|
- name: '电网受累'
|
|
|
|
- }, {
|
|
|
|
- color: 'bg-yellow',
|
|
|
|
- name: '天气受累'
|
|
|
|
- }, {
|
|
|
|
- color: 'bg-cyan',
|
|
|
|
- name: '限电降出'
|
|
|
|
- }, {
|
|
|
|
- color: 'bg-mauve',
|
|
|
|
- name: '限电停机'
|
|
|
|
- }, {
|
|
|
|
- color: 'bg-pink',
|
|
|
|
- name: '待风损失'
|
|
|
|
- }, {
|
|
|
|
- color: 'bg-brown',
|
|
|
|
- name: '手动停机'
|
|
|
|
- }, {
|
|
|
|
- color: 'bg-pink2',
|
|
|
|
- name: '正常发电'
|
|
|
|
- }, {
|
|
|
|
- color: 'bg-blue2',
|
|
|
|
- name: '缺陷降出'
|
|
|
|
- }],
|
|
|
|
- dataUpDown: [] //功能暂未完成,前端部分table表头点击不了
|
|
|
|
};
|
|
};
|
|
},
|
|
},
|
|
created() {
|
|
created() {
|
|
@@ -472,7 +441,7 @@
|
|
});
|
|
});
|
|
},
|
|
},
|
|
mxClick() {
|
|
mxClick() {
|
|
- this.$router.push("/decision1")
|
|
|
|
|
|
+ this.$router.push("/decision/decision1")
|
|
},
|
|
},
|
|
thClick: function(i) {
|
|
thClick: function(i) {
|
|
console.log(i) // 当子组件触发按钮时,msg获取值为 哈哈啊哈哈
|
|
console.log(i) // 当子组件触发按钮时,msg获取值为 哈哈啊哈哈
|